Summary of the Mercedes Benz A-Class (1998-2005)

Price Range: £14,290 to £18,645

Assets

Room, versatility, ease of driving, view out, compactness, image, individuality

Drawbacks

Pricing, choppy ride, unyielding seats, patchy quality, crude diesels, small boot

Verdict

Hugely versatile, easy to drive and economical to run, but pricey and not as robust as other Mercedes

Mercedes A-Class Review

Safety and Security4 out of 5

After an early and unfortunate encounter, in which the A-Class literally fell over during a Swedish moose-avoidance test, Mercedes' smallest model was re-engineered with revised suspension and skid-countering electronic stability programme as standard. All cars sold in the UK have been equipped with this. The A-Class scored four stars in the NCAP crash tests, though it was tested in 1999, since when the criteria have been tightened. Four airbags are standard equipment, as are ABS anti-lock brakes; head 'bags are an option.
